32 | Allegation: Uncleared adult is residing in the home.
According to the allegation, an uncleared male adult, Person #1 (P1), is residing in the home. Licensee stated P1 does not live in the home. LPA obtained a declaration signed by Licensee listing the names of all person’s living in the home. LPA observed P1 is not on the list and all adult’s licensee states live in the home have fingerprint clearance and are associated to the facility, per the Guardian fingerprint database. Interviews conducted with licensee, licensee’s assistant, parents of children in care, and children in care revealed no disclosures regarding P1 or another adult who is not fingerprint cleared living in the home. During a complaint visit on 9/20/23, LPA Lopez did observe and take pictures of vehicle license plates and vehicle registration listing the name of P1. The items were observed by LPA in the room next to the day care room. The room contained a bed, male shoes, and male clothing in the closet. Licensee stated during an interview that the room the items were observed in “It’s an extra room. I also use it for storage”. Licensee stated the men’s clothing observed in the room are “extra clothes for my husband, grandson, and my sons”. During visits on 10/3/23 and 11/30/23 LPA Babcock observed shampoo in the bathroom shower attached to the bedroom. LPA did not observe a toothbrush or toothpaste, or other toiletries during the visits.
Although the allegation may have happened or is valid, there is not a preponderance of evidence to prove the alleged violation did or did not occur, therefore the allegation is unsubstantiated.
